How fast is YouFibre, really?
Full fibre delivers its advertised speed regardless of your distance from the exchange, unlike the copper-based products it replaces. See FTTP vs FTTC vs cable for what the labels mean.

Price rises: what actually happens
None. Price fixed for the full contract.
No mid-contract price rises. YouFibre locks your price for the entire contract. In a market where inflation-linked increases are standard, this is one of the strongest reasons to choose an altnet.
